ROME MAN ARRESTED FOR SEXUALLY ABUSING A CHILD

According to Oneida County Sheriff's Chief Deputy Derrick O'Meara of the Child Advocacy Center A Rome man was arrested this morning and charged with

abusing a child earlier this month.

Rome Police Detective E.A. D'Alessandro, of the Child Advocacy Center charged Michael P. Egelston, 26, of Rome's inner district, after a several week long investigation. Det. D'Alessandro said Egelston was charged with both, Sexual Abuse in the third degree and Endangering the welfare of a child, regarding an incident that occurred in Rome's inner district during the overnight hours of May 31, 2019 into June 1, 2019. D'Alessandro stated that Egelston was arrested and processed at the Rome Police Department and is currently awaiting arraignment in Rome City lockup.

Det. D'Alessandro requested an order of protection be issued on behalf of the victim.

The victim has been offered counseling through the Child Advocacy Center.

The investigation is continuing and additional charges are possible, according to Det. D'Alessandro.
